当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

一台主机两人独立操作怎么设置,一台主机两人独立操作的设置与优化指南

一台主机两人独立操作怎么设置,一台主机两人独立操作的设置与优化指南

一台主机两人独立操作可以通过虚拟化技术实现,使用VMware Workstation或VirtualBox等软件创建多个虚拟机(VM),每个用户可以登录自己的虚拟机进行...

一台主机两人独立操作可以通过虚拟化技术实现,使用VMware Workstation或VirtualBox等软件创建多个虚拟机(VM),每个用户可以登录自己的虚拟机进行独立的操作,确保主机有足够的硬件资源来支持多个虚拟机的运行,并合理分配CPU、内存和网络带宽,还可以通过配置网络设置来实现不同虚拟机之间的通信和资源共享。

在许多情况下,我们需要在一台主机的环境中进行多人协同工作或同时执行多个任务,这种需求可能出现在软件开发、系统维护或者数据分析等领域,本文将详细介绍如何在一台主机上实现两个人独立操作的方法和技巧。

一台主机两人独立操作怎么设置,一台主机两人独立操作的设置与优化指南

图片来源于网络,如有侵权联系删除

硬件准备与安装环境

(1)硬件要求:

  • 主机:至少配备双核处理器,8GB内存,500GB硬盘空间以上。
  • 显示器:两台或多台显示器以支持多窗口显示。
  • 外设:键盘、鼠标等输入设备。

(2)操作系统选择:

推荐使用Linux发行版如Ubuntu Server,因为它具有较好的多用户支持和安全性,也可以考虑Windows Server,但请注意其成本较高且不如Linux稳定。

(3)软件安装:

确保已安装必要的开发工具和环境(例如Java Development Kit, Python解释器等),以及任何其他所需的应用程序和服务。

配置多用户登录与管理权限

(1)创建新账户:

在系统中添加第二个管理员账号,以便于不同人员可以分别登录并进行操作。

(2)分配管理权限:

为每个账号分配相应的管理权限,以确保安全性和数据隔离。

(3)设置密码策略:

制定严格的密码政策,包括长度、复杂度等方面的要求,以增强系统的安全性。

使用远程桌面协议(RDP)

(1)启用远程桌面服务:

在Windows Server中打开“远程桌面”功能;而在Linux环境下,可以使用X Window System或其他图形界面服务器来实现远程访问。

(2)配置防火墙规则:

允许外部网络连接到本地机器上的特定端口,通常为3389(对于Windows)或6000+(对于Linux)。

(3)建立安全的SSH隧道:

通过SSH加密通道来传输数据,提高通信的安全性。

利用虚拟化技术

(1)安装VMware Workstation Pro/Oracle VM VirtualBox等虚拟化软件:

这些工具允许在同一物理机上运行多个独立的操作系统实例,从而实现不同的应用程序和工作流程并行运行而不互相干扰。

(2)创建和管理虚拟机:

为每个人分配一个独立的虚拟机,并在其中安装所需的操作系统和应用软件。

(3)共享资源:

合理分配CPU、内存和网络带宽等资源,以满足各自的需求。

应用程序级隔离

(1)容器化部署:

采用Docker等技术将应用及其依赖项打包成容器,可以在同一主机上独立运行多个版本的相同应用。

(2)微服务架构:

设计微服务架构使得各个模块之间相互独立,便于开发和测试。

数据备份与恢复策略

(1)定期备份数据:

确保重要数据和配置文件的副本存放在安全位置,以防万一发生故障时能够迅速恢复。

(2)选择合适的备份方法:

根据具体情况选用全盘备份、增量备份或差异备份等方式。

一台主机两人独立操作怎么设置,一台主机两人独立操作的设置与优化指南

图片来源于网络,如有侵权联系删除

(3)测试恢复过程:

定期演练数据恢复步骤,验证备份的有效性。

安全措施

(1)更新补丁:

及时下载并安装最新的安全补丁,修补已知漏洞。

(2)监控日志:

启用系统日志记录功能,实时监控异常行为。

(3)实施入侵检测系统(IDS):

部署IDS以识别潜在的攻击尝试并及时响应。

(4)加强网络安全:

使用防火墙、VPN和其他网络安全设备保护内部网络免受外部威胁。

性能优化与监控

(1)分析性能瓶颈:

利用各种诊断工具(如top、vmstat、iostat等)分析当前系统的负载情况,找出性能瓶颈所在。

(2)调整资源配置:

根据实际需要动态调整CPU、内存和网络资源的分配比例。

(3)优化代码效率:

对关键业务逻辑进行性能调优,减少不必要的计算量和IO操作。

(4)持续监控:

使用Zabbix、Nagios等开源监控系统对整个IT基础设施进行全面监测。

文档管理与知识分享

(1)建立文档库:

集中存放所有相关的技术文档、操作手册和使用指南。

(2)定期培训:

组织定期的技术培训和研讨会,提升团队成员的技术水平。

(3)鼓励知识共享:

提倡跨部门的知识交流和协作,形成良好的学习氛围。

(4)记录最佳实践:

总结成功的经验和失败的教训,形成标准化的操作流程。

总结与展望

通过上述一系列的措施和方法,我们成功地在一台主机上实现了两个人独立操作的目标,这不仅提高了工作效率,还增强了系统的可靠性和安全性,随着技术的不断进步和发展,我们也需要不断地学习和探索新的技术和方法,以适应未来的挑战和机遇,让我们携手共进,共创美好的未来!

黑狐家游戏

发表评论

最新文章